Leading Chemical Company 1000 Crores
Experience : 4-8 years
Education : BE+MBA Premier Institutes only (IIM, FMS, NITIE, MDI, JBIMS, SP Jain )
Reporting to : Head of Supply Chain/COO
Responsibilities:
- Define and manage supply chain strategies for the company
- Manage and optimize the Supply Chain in co-operation with marketing team, logistics team and other business partners
- Carry out production planning/master scheduling activities, including order management, resource planning, delivery promising (ATP management), and production forecasting and reporting of actual manufacturing results vs. plan. Provide back up to certain planning functions.
- Implement best practice process and organization for planning. Continuously optimize planning, order to cash processes
- Define and ensure implementation of measures to fulfill Net Working Capital Budget
- Responsible for inventory and availability (raw materials, intermediates and local finished and traded products)
- Continuous improvement of slow-movers and dead stocks
- Translate the marketing forecast into resource requirements to assess team capabilities versus forecast requirements. This includes material requirements planning based on the forecast.
- Measure and compare actual production results against the production plan and forecast.
- Responsible for Operations Review Meeting (capacity, production, shipments) and explanation of changes.
- Facilitate adjustments to ATP as required to reflect actual plant performance and realized production rates. Identify adjustments needed in resource allocations based on such changes.
- Define and implement supply chain cost savings measures in collaboration with Regional Marketing and Sales and Regional Logistics. Continuously optimize regional network according to business needs
- Serve as a lead for all supply chain Black/Green Belt projects that are performed within the department. Determine scope of improvement projects; initiate and lead improvement projects as necessary. Develop reports and analysis for continuous improvement.
- Lead new system implementation projects and initiatives within Supply Chain department
- Use strong system skills and business knowledge to examine the effectiveness of supply chain operations and to communicate conclusions.
- Analyze internal and external processes (benchmarking) to maximize efficiency of function and systems.
- Degree in supply chain or APICS certification preferred
- Prior supervisory experience
- Knowledge and understanding of Manufacturing Execution Systems and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) systems. Knowledge & experience of SAP and in-depth understanding of Excel, PowerPoint
- Experience, training or certification of Lean and/or Six Sigma/Performance Excellence. Green Belt certification preferred.
Essential skills required to do this job:
- Strong analytical abilities, with attention to detail.
- Demonstrated decision making and problem solving skills
- Comprehensive PC skills
Additional desired skills:
- Ensure efficient functional and operational structure and task delegation interfacing globally in a global organization.
- Project management know-how and hands-on use and roll out experience of SAP (or equivalent ERP system) in the areas of demand planning, inventory planning, master planning, procurement and scheduling
- Experience in leading and managing a business support team
